Customer Service Representative jobs in Montgomery, North Carolina involve assisting customers with inquiries, resolving issues, and providing information about products or services. Responsibilities may include answering phone calls, responding to emails, and ensuring customer satisfaction. Experience in customer service and strong communication skills are typically required for these positions. Customer Service Representatives in Montgomery, North Carolina, play a crucial role in providing assistance and support to customers in various industries. - Entry-level Customer Service Representative salaries range from $25,000 to $35,000 per year - Mid-career Customer Support Specialist salaries range from $35,000 to $45,000 per year - Senior-level Client Success Manager salaries range from $45,000 to $60,000 per year The history of customer service representatives in Montgomery, North Carolina, can be traced back to the early days of telephone operators and mail-in inquiries. Over time, with the advancement of technology, customer service has evolved to include various communication channels such as email, live chat, and social media. As customer service continues to evolve, representatives in Montgomery, North Carolina, are adapting to new trends in the industry. This includes the integration of artificial intelligence and chatbots to streamline processes, as well as a focus on providing personalized and empathetic support to customers. Overall, Customer Service Representatives in Montgomery, North Carolina, play a vital role in ensuring customer satisfaction and building strong relationships with clients. Their ability to adapt to changing trends and technologies is crucial in providing high-quality service in today's competitive market.
